Transaction fab5c61cd884ef96d764b53724fd13343db640edea4bb91647316286986d36c4
1 Input
1 Output
-
fab5c61cd884ef96d764b53724fd13343db640edea4bb91647316286986d36c4:0
- value
- 499995776
- script pubkey
- OP_0 OP_PUSHBYTES_20 8cd75fefa7ae3d1d843222b541660894895b64d2
- address
- bc1q3nt4lma84c73mppjy265zesgjjy4kexj67uvzc